From Boscoreale - Via Promiscua, 48 to Parete by bus and train
To get from Boscoreale - Via Promiscua, 48 to Parete you’ll need to take 2 train lines and one bus line: take the L4 train from Boscoreale station to Naples Garibaldi station. Next, you’ll have to switch to the R train and finally take the 08/A-CE bus from Aversa Station - Piazza Mazzini station to Via Marconi - Building 9 (Hunters Association) station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 2 hr 7 min. The bus and train schedule from Boscoreale - Via Promiscua, 48 may change.
